Output 2380d96f3256f8bdd1bab75672e90e7e524c708fd4d1fdd1bae03295c122d90d:1

value
36398129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ec4795c7b70fb5b06ccdedb82af07f524233a85 OP_EQUAL
address
3EhuF3LrHsQkzQpbxyZwKZK4hHLvwT4YLt
transaction
2380d96f3256f8bdd1bab75672e90e7e524c708fd4d1fdd1bae03295c122d90d
spent
true